This cache is hidden by the lighthouse on the eastern peak of the island.


The current light on Ironbound was built in 1871 to replace the previous light that had been destroyed the year before. Unlike most lighthouses these days the light tower and lightkeeper's house are not seperate buildings. According to "A Brief History of Canadian Lighthouses", having the lightkeeper's house built into the lighthouse was a characteristic of lighthouses built during 1870-1900. Therefore the Ironbound light would have been one of the earliest examples built during that period. It was also probably one of the last manned lighthouses in the area with an assistant light keeper right up till 1990.
